One of the primary ways to enhance knee comfort is through proper footwear. Shoes that provide adequate cushioning, arch support, and a good fit are crucial. Opting for shoes designed for your specific activity—be it running, walking, or hiking—ensures that your feet and knees are well-supported. It’s advisable to visit a specialty store where professionals can assess your gait and recommend the best shoes for your needs. Remember, an ill-fitting pair can lead to misalignment, causing undue stress on your knees.
Incorporating a warm-up routine before any exercise is vital for knee health. Warming up increases blood flow to the muscles and prepares your joints for activity. Simple dynamic stretches, such as leg swings and gentle lunges, can loosen the tendons and ligaments around the knee. A warm-up session should be tailored to your specific exercise; for walking, gentle leg lifts and ankle circles are effective in preventing injury.
Strength training is another excellent method for supporting knee comfort. Building strength in the muscles surrounding the knee—particularly in the quadriceps, hamstrings, and calves—can alleviate pressure on the knee joint itself. Resistance exercises such as squats, step-ups, and leg presses target these muscle groups. However, it’s crucial to perform these exercises correctly to avoid causing harm. Engaging a trainer or utilizing instructional videos can ensure proper form.
Flexibility is equally important. Tight muscles can contribute to knee pain and discomfort, so regular stretching is essential. Focus on stretching not only the muscles around your knees but also your hip flexors and lower back. Incorporating yoga or Pilates into your routine will enhance your overall flexibility while also promoting balance and stability.
Weight management plays an important role in maintaining knee comfort. Excess weight adds more stress to your knees, especially during weight-bearing activities like walking and running. Engaging in a balanced diet combined with regular exercise can help you achieve a healthy weight. Even a modest reduction in weight can significantly decrease the pressure on your knees, enhancing your comfort during physical activities.

Finally, listen to your body. If you experience persistent pain during or after walking or exercising, don’t hesitate to seek medical advice. Early intervention can prevent long-term issues and allow you to participate in activities you enjoy without discomfort. Professionals may recommend physical therapy, which can provide personalized exercises and treatments to strengthen your knees and improve your movement.
